Psychological and behavioral causes of insomnia in youngsters

Kids are very delicate to emotional and behavioral modifications, making their sleep habits prone to stress and routine modifications. If the thoughts continues to be overstimulated or anxious, it’ll be troublesome for youngsters to transition to a peaceful, sleep-ready state. Understanding these psychological and behavioral triggers is essential to addressing the basis causes of insomnia in youngsters.

1. Nervousness, stress and emotional triggers

Kids might occupy problem falling asleep in the event that they are apprehensive about college, friendships, or household modifications. Nervousness prompts the nervous system and makes it troublesome for youngsters to chill out earlier than mattress.
In accordance with the Nationwide Institute of Psychological Well beingNervousness can result in physiological hyperarousal and straight have an effect on the capacity to topple asleep.

2. Irregular bedtimes and poor sleep hygiene

Inconsistent routines are some of the frequent behavioral causes of insomnia in youngsters. Kids who do not preserve a predictable bedtime schedule usually occupy problem attending to relaxation. Display publicity – particularly inside an hour of bedtime – suppresses melatonin and delays sleep onset. In accordance with analysis by Harvard Medical CollegeBlue gentle from screens delays circadian rhythms and melatonin secretion and worsens insomnia in each adults and kids.

3. Parasomnias and nocturnal issues

Night time terrors, sleepwalking, and complicated states of agitation sometimes happen when youngsters are overtired or occupy stressed sleep. These episodes might be horrifying for mother and father, however are often innocent and momentary. Parasomnias are extra frequent in youngsters with irregular sleep patterns or insufficient relaxation. These psychological and behavioral elements contribute considerably to insomnia in youngsters, particularly preschool and elementary school-aged youngsters.

Medical, environmental and dietary elements in pediatric sleep

Not all sleep issues are on account of feelings or routines – many youngsters occupy grief sleeping on account of medical or environmental circumstances. Food regimen, allergic reactions, respiratory issues, and family habits can occupy a big influence on how properly a little one sleeps at night time. Recognizing these bodily and environmental elements helps mother and father catch a extra complete strategy to bettering sleep in youngsters.

1. Ob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) and respiratory issues

OSA impacts an estimated 1-5% of youngsters and is usually prompted by enlarged tonsils or weight problems. Paused respiratory prevents youngsters from sleeping deeply, resulting in daytime sleepiness and irritability. In accordance with the US Nationwide Library of MedicationUntreated sleep apnea can have an effect on cognitive growth, progress and conduct.

2. Dietary triggers and stimulants

Sure meals could cause sleep issues. Caffeine, sugar, chocolate and heavy dinners can do you are feeling unwell or overstimulated. Reflux, meals intolerances or allergic reactions additionally disrupt youngsters’s sleep. Kids who eat merchandise containing caffeine – even within the afternoon – might expertise a delay in falling asleep and extra frequent awakenings at night time.

3. Irregular schedules and extreme napping

Skipping naps or sleeping too lengthy throughout the day impacts nighttime rhythms. With no constant wake-sleep rhythm, youngsters discover it troublesome to manage their inside clock.

4. Situations akin to Stressed Legs Syndrome (RLS)

Though RLS is much less frequent in youngsters, it might probably trigger uncomfortable sensations within the legs that may result in restlessness at bedtime or waking up at night time. Low iron ranges or genetic elements might contribute to RLS signs. These medical and environmental influences considerably influence youngsters’s sleep and infrequently require analysis by a pediatrician or sleep specialist.

Hidden on a regular basis habits that disrupt youngsters’s sleep

Even small on a regular basis routines can have an effect on youngsters’s sleep at night time. These habits could seem innocent throughout the day, however they’ll result in sensory overload, disrupt pure circadian rhythms, or do it tougher for youngsters to transition right into a peaceful, sleepy state. Dad and mom usually overlook these seemingly insignificant behaviors, however they’ll considerably influence a little one’s capacity to topple asleep rapidly and keep asleep all through the night time. Understanding how these small elements match into the greater image can back mother and father create a extra constant, structured, and calming bedtime setting that promotes higher relaxation.

  • Late Day Bodily Exercise: Train is wholesome, however intense gaming too near bedtime can improve adrenaline ranges, improve core physique temperature, and improve coronary heart price – all of which delay leisure. Power-intensive actions like operating, leaping, or aggressive sports activities can preserve children engaged longer than anticipated and push bedtime later than supposed.
  • Inconsistent weekend plans: Permitting children to not sleep late on weekends might look like a innocent deal with, however it might probably set their inside clocks again by hours and create a “social jet lag” impact. This inconsistency makes it troublesome for youngsters to topple asleep on college nights and may result in daytime sleepiness, moodiness, or decreased focus.
  • Radiant lighting within the night: LED ceiling lights, tv screens and brightly lit rooms suppress melatonin manufacturing and ship a sign to the mind that it remains to be daytime. Even a further hour of publicity can delay sleepiness, particularly in youthful youngsters who’re delicate to gentle stimuli. Switching to heat, dim lighting within the night can back the physique chill out naturally.

Incessantly requested questions

1. What causes night time terrors in comparison with nightmares in youngsters?

Night time terrors happen throughout deep sleep (non-REM sleep) and are sometimes related to overtiredness or stress. Nightmares happen throughout REM sleep and are often triggered by fears or anxieties that the little one can bear in mind.

2. How a lot display screen time earlier than mattress impacts youngsters’s insomnia?

Utilizing screens inside one hour Half of the bedtime can considerably delay sleep by suppressing melatonin. Proscribing gadgets after dinner helps enhance sleep high quality.

3. Can dietary modifications enhance youngsters’s sleep issues?

Sure. Avoiding caffeine, lowering sugar consumption, and avoiding heavy meals earlier than mattress usually back. Figuring out allergic reactions or meals intolerances may enhance restoration.

4. When ought to mother and father search back for youngsters’s sleep issues?

Search skilled back if sleep issues persist for a number of weeks, if loud night breathing or pauses in respiratory happen, or if sleep deprivation impacts daytime functioning or conduct.
